An IPA (iOS App Store Package) file is Apple's proprietary archive format for distributing iOS applications. Think of it as the iOS equivalent of an Android APK — a compressed container that holds the app's executable code, assets, and metadata. Legitimate IPA files are cryptographically signed by Apple to ensure authenticity and integrity. When you download an app from the App Store, Apple's servers provide an encrypted, signed IPA that can only run on authorized devices.
